A fire is raging in western Moscow over an area of 5,500 square meters (almost 60,000 square feet), the Russian capital’s emergencies authorities inform.

Earlier it was reported that a three-stored building at Kutuzovsky Prospekt was hit by the fire of the third category of complexity.

The cause of the fire, according to preliminary data, was the malfunction of electrical equipment, according to a RIA Novosti source in the emergency services.

"The preliminary cause — faulty electrical equipment," — the source said.

​"Fire area is 5000 square meters", — stated in the emergencies report published in the microblog on Twitter.

An emergencies source told RIA Novosti that helicopters could be used at the onset of dawn to help extinguish the blaze.

There has been no information on casualties or damages.

The fire erupted at a former brewery in the early hours of Thursday.
